How can we REMOVE the Microsoft XP control alt delete login
requirement?

On my Windows XP SP1 computer number 1, the login screen just asks for
a password.

On my Windows XP SP1 computer number 2, the login screen insists first
on the three-fingered salute. Only after pressing control + alt +
delete will Windows XP computer number 2 allow me to enter my login.

Nobody uses computer number 2 'cept me.

How can I REMOVE the need for the Microsoft XP control alt delete
requirement before entering my password to log in.

Orak said:
How can we REMOVE the Microsoft XP control alt delete login
requirement?

Run "control userpasswords2" and select the "Advanced" tab. Uncheck
"require users to press Ctl+Alt+Delete".

As near as I can tell, MS forgot to put that option on the XP User
Accounts control panel, but they left the Win2K User Accounts control
panel in place as an option.

Go to Start | Run | type in "control userpasswords2" withouth the
quotes. Click ok. On the advanced tab remove the check mark in Require
users to press Ctrl+Alt+Delete.

You can add this dialog box to the Control Panel with a name of User
Accounts 2 by a tweak at Kellys-Korner:

Add Control User Passwords2 to the Control Panel (Line 1)
http://www.kellys-korner-xp.com/xp_tweaks.htm
